About The Railway Children

Follow Bobbie, Peter and Phyllis as they are suddenly uprooted from their London home and taken to the countryside, where a new world awaits them. As they explore their surroundings, they’re drawn to the railway at the bottom of the garden and the characters they meet along the way.

The amphitheatre is nestled into the heart of the sculpture park, surrounded by nature and artwork. Hand built out of local Cotswold stone, this really is one of the most unique venues to enjoy some traditional English open-air theatre.

Is Cotswold Sculpture Park wheelchiar accessible?

Cotswold Sculpture Park is home to a Mobility Scooter for visitors to use. 

This is because wheelchair users may have difficulty on the gravelled pathways, and the mobility scooter is easy to use and doesn't struggle on the outdoor terrain. 

Unfortunately there are no disabled toilets onsite at this time.

What happens if it rains at The Railway Children at Cotswold Sculpture Park?

The show will go ahead in most weather conditions, as is traditional with open-air theatre. In heavy showers, there is an undercover area, and in extreme weather the performance may be moved to an alternative indoor venue.

Can I bring my own seating to The Railway Children at Cotswold Sculpture Park?

No, visitors are asked not to bring their own seating as it may block views. The amphitheatre provides seating, and you can bring cushions or blankets for comfort.
